Long-term remission and incidence of recurrence of neovascularization in intravitreal injection treated exudative age-related macular degeneration.

Purpose: This study evaluates the long-term remission (LTR) rate, recurrence rate, and prognostic factors of extended remission and recurrence in macular neovascularization (MNV) eyes treated with aflibercept.

Methods: This was a retrospective cohort of treatment-naïve MNV eyes treated in Shin Kong Wu Ho-Su Memorial Hospital, Taipei, Taiwan with intravitreal aflibercept between 2015 and 2023. Patients followed pro re nata (PRN) or Treat-and-Extend (T&E) protocols. Long-term remission (LTR) was defined as over 6 months of disease inactivity without injection. Binary logistic regression and Cox proportional hazard regression assessed associations with LTR and time to recurrence.

Results: Of 144 eyes, 68.75% achieved LTR after an average of 21.32 months after treatment, with no difference between PRN and T&E groups. Among LTR cases, 69.7% experienced recurrence after a median 15 months (range: 6 ~ 67). Firth multinomial logistic regression found younger age [OR, 0.898 (0.836 to 0.946; p = 0.032)], fewer injections per year [OR, 0 (0.000 to 0.001; p = 0.004)], polypoid choroidal vasculopathy (PCV) [OR, 6.170 (1.811 to 21.039; p = 0.033)], and retinal angiomatous proliferation (RAP) [OR, 24 450.658 (24 450.657 to 24 450.658; p < 0.001)] associated with LTR. Cox regression showed more yearly injections [HR, 7.621(0.376 to 0.972; p = 0.038)] led to earlier recurrence, while baseline subretinal fluid (SRF) [HR, 0.604 (0.376 to 0.972; p = 0.038)] delayed recurrence.

Conclusion: Implementing our exit strategies, 68.75% of eyes achieved LTR across the two injection protocols. Age, disease subtype, baseline anatomical features, and yearly injection numbers may predict sustained remission and a longer time to experience recurrence.
